Bargaon Population - Chatra, Jharkhand
Bargaon is a medium size village located in Itkhori Block of Chatra district, Jharkhand with total 111 families residing. The Bargaon village has population of 720 of which 367 are males while 353 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Bargaon village population of children with age 0-6 is 129 which makes up 17.92 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bargaon village is 962 which is higher than Jharkhand state average of 948. Child Sex Ratio for the Bargaon as per census is 1081, higher than Jharkhand average of 948.
Bargaon village has higher literacy rate compared to Jharkh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Bargaon village was 72.76 % compared to 66.41 % of Jharkhand. In Bargaon Male literacy stands at 80.33 % while female literacy rate was 64.69 %.

Bargaon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 111 | - | - |
Population | 720 | 367 | 353 |
Child (0-6) | 129 | 62 | 67 |
Schedule Caste | 264 | 132 | 132 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 72.76 % | 80.33 % | 64.69 % |
Total Workers | 183 | 170 | 13 |
Main Worker | 14 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 169 | 163 | 6 |
